Changelog History
-
v1.4.2.0 Changes
September 28, 2020๐ Bugfix sepCap backtracking when sep fails
๐ See replace-megaparsec/issues/33
-
v1.4.1.0
June 16, 2020 -
v1.4.0.0 Changes
May 07, 2020๐ Running Parsers: Add
splitCap
andbreakCap
.๐ Parser Combinators: Add
anyTill
. -
v1.2.2.0
April 01, 2020 -
v1.2.1.0
March 22, 2020 -
v1.2.0.0 Changes
November 01, 2019Benchmark improvements
Specializations of the
sepCap
function, guided by replace-benchmark.๐ New benchmarks
๐ | Program | dense | sparse | | :--- | ---: | ---: | โ |
Replace.Attoparsec.ByteString.streamEdit
| 394.12ms | 41.13ms | ๐ |Replace.Attoparsec.Text.streamEdit
| 515.26ms | 46.10ms |Old benchmarks
๐ | Program | dense | sparse | | :--- | ---: | ---: | โ |
Replace.Attoparsec.ByteString.streamEdit
| 537.57ms | 407.33ms | ๐ |Replace.Attoparsec.Text.streamEdit
| 549.62ms | 280.96ms |Also don't export
getOffset
anymore. It's too complicated to explain ๐ what it means forText
. If users want to know positional parsing information ๐ then they should use Megaparsec. -
v1.0.3.0
October 17, 2019 -
v1.0.2.0
September 16, 2019 -
v1.0.1.0
September 12, 2019 -
v1.0.0.0 Changes
September 10, 2019- First version.